    Drop the pan (not too bad on a 4x4) and check for cracks. If everything looks good, slap in a new oil pump and seal it up. If you have a 2-piece rear seal, could be a good time to refresh it. Use a later model high volume pump if you think you should. Hung jury on that one.

    If you had good compression, I see no reason to pull the engine. It's very likely you'd just be replacing the same parts. If you have doubts, Plastigage the bearings (rarely any problem there). If you aren't pulling the heads, I wouldn't sweat it. If you need to replace the lifters, it can be done with heads on (enginuity and patients may be required).

    If you are already pulling heads, it's a toss-up. I've done them in and out, and it's just about a wash, comparing convience, time and busted knuckles.

    There is only one "type" of head bolts. Fel-Pro is the preferred brand, but I'm not aware of a "bad" brand. They cannot be reused, they are TTY (torque to yield). The only other option is studs, and an in-frame R&R is not fun with them (pull the engine), but is possible. No advantage to studs with stock to moderate bombing, but wouldn't hurt, either.

    Yank it out yank it out.

    The engine is so much easier to work on and to see what you need to see while on a stand.

    There are several things that will need work at the miles on the clock you have.

    Soft plugs will almost certainly be near rotted though.
    I have not seen any high milers that were not.

    Yank it all apart and be sure and steel stamp the rods on the pan rail side on the part line as GM does not do this.

    A minimum you can steam the thing down good and then see what you have.

    A small coolant leak is most likely #2 or #7 cylinder head gasket thats about to die a violent death. I say this from experience, been there done that.

    You can also assess the condition of the heads the block, crank, cam ect.

    If all is ok a valve grind along with a light hone on the cylinders and some fresh rings and bearings and a few gaskets and seals and a rattle can of black paint and your off to the rodeo.

    I did this very thing a year ago on our 94 Burb.

    Its far easier to work on these little cretures out of the truck.

    You can really get a good look at the main webs with loads of daylight after a good steam cleaning.

    At home the easiest way to check for cracks is to use a propane torch and warm the web areas at the outer bolt holes on both sides until hot.
    Any cracks will bubble oil really good if they are present.

    The cracks many times are not visible to the eye even when the sucker is clean without doing this.


    Have the crank magged and probaly a nice pollish is all it will need.

    While you are there you can look the cam over well too. be sure to bag them lifters up and mark them though.

    Most of these engines will be fine with just a new timing chain as the sprockets dont wear much.


    Watch ebay and bearings and rings can be found real right if you know prices and such.

    These engines use select fit bearings on both rods and mains.
    I have seen Std Std and also unders std and so on but never mismatched between rods.

    The rods will usually all the be the same size and so will the mains.
    The numbers will be on the inserts if they are still from Ma General

    This is all metric sizing. the numbers will be followed by US

    You can also find the upper and lower shells on the same throw a different size.

    If they are all close to STD use STD bearings.
    Mine had some .0005 (in inches) under rods but I used STDs as the select fit stuff is only available from the MA General and they are spendy.

    Clevite 77 is a good choice on bearings.

    OH BTW when I yanked the 94 down the only thing I removed was the hood I blocked the radiator with some plywood.
    The engine will come out very easy.
    I used my BOBCAT and hung an air chain hoist and did the whole removal myself. (Except removal of the hood)

    Easy job from where you are now. Get rid of the exhaust manifolds before you pull and then replace them after the fresh one is back in.

    There is plenty of room otherwise.
    The only nasty is getting the two upper bell housing bolts out as the fuel lines run up to a bracket that is attached with stud tops and lock nuts there.

    #2 and #7 are the low ones. My bet says #7 is leaking water and this may also be why the compression is low.

    Get the little beast out and do a post mortem on it and go from there.

    All is not lost. As long as your block and crank are good your set.
    The pistons and rods generally fair well in these too.
    Look for the normal stuff such as scuffing and so on.
    The piston crowns in these have a hard Black coating on them to help reject heat. Inspect them carefully in the area around the Recardo Bowl for any sign of cracks.

    The valve seals are not all the great in these engines and when they fail you can get a fair amount of oil seep down the valve guides.

    If the cylinder has a minimal ridge at the top probably a hone and re-ring is all it will need.

    Your compression on all but 2 & 7 are fine. The 380 is the one that runs up the red flag.

    The head gaskets at the 2-7 locations are notorious for failing. The gasket soft material goes away over time from the coolant presence and then the fire ring will corrode and poof its over.

    As long as there is no nasty etching into the block from the fire ring you wont have to deck the block.
    Felpro makes a .010" thicker gasket to allow for a deck job.

    Regarding blow-by. GMCTD had posted the following in a thread some time back in response to a CDR question I had:

    Then, engine idling at op temp, pull the dipstick

    Place a 36" length of 3/8" clear vinyl tubing over the dipstick tube

    Place the open end in a container of water

    Keep it much lower than the dipstick tube - prevents water in the crankcase

    At 2000rpm, the water should rise in the tube about 1-2"

    The higher the water level in the tube, the more restrictive the air filter - dirty, wet, etc.

    Bubbles in the water means excess blow-by

    If it blows all the water outta the container, ya gots really big problems.

    But, the test should give you some indication of how much oil to expect thru the CDR

    Dr Lee suggested to (regarding block cracks) :
    just wipe down the bearing-web inner block areas to clean them up good ...
    then take like a coffee break , and when you come back , the oil should have visibly emerged from any cracks.

    In most cases the lower end bearings are OK, and the cranks are fine if the dampener is maintained.

    John Kennedy suggests removal of engine when replacing heads just to enable resurfacing the firedeck (upper mating surface of block tends to be eroded/corroded where headgasket compresses ring onto castiron block surface).

    Robyn has had good luck with head rebuilds . I think the heads , at $500/ea from peninsular , are cheap enough to be considered disposable. I also think they are by design disposed to cracking , by virtue of the induction-hardened seats. And the new OEM heads have larger coolant passages....

    I removed some block "freeze-out" plugs , and found them to be absolutely free of any corrosion on my '95 with 175K Mi -- the aluminum radiator also had NO indications of any corrosion at all ... courtesy of the pink coolant.

    I would not worry about the compression [the one cylinder IS a bit low] , but if you have the time to go over it , it would be nice to pull the rod bearings , and measure bore wear. Six of my bores were worn .002 oversize , the other two were worn .007" oversize. I think one of my pistons has a little slap , esp at certain temps.

    IFF you establish No obvious block cracks , then you really know something useful...

    My feeling is replacing the headgaskets is good insurance , but it is a job , too.
